## Runbook: Cron → Workflow Migration (Driftless)

We're moving the old cron jobs on the Harkwell boxes into the Driftless workflow engine. Each migrated job gets a signed definition, and the engine refuses unsigned ones — that's the main control you'll care about. Secrets come from the vault sidecar, never from env files. The engine's current settings are listed below.

settings of faweg-tahop:
ISTAX_PIN=8134
ISTAX_METRICS_HOST=metrics.istax.tolvaqcorp.internal
ISTAX_LOG_LEVEL=debug
ISTAX_TENANT=caseth

TURN-208: Gatevale turnstile counters at the Merrow Field pilot double-count when a rotation reverses mid-cycle. Attendance totals drift roughly 2% high per event. The debounce window fix is implemented, reviewed by Ilsa, and soak-tested across two simulated match days without drift. Ready for your cut; the candidate build is identified below.

trace token, tagag-tafog: htk6_5ed18c

Minutes — Management Meeting, Harleton Branch Network

Quick one, folks. Our cover with Bramwell Mutual comes up for renewal at the end of next quarter, and premiums are heading up roughly 12% across the board. Teja walked us through two alternative quotes from Orvale Assurance, both cheaper but with thinner liability terms. We agreed Dana will push Bramwell for a loyalty discount before we jump ship. Branch managers: flag any open claims by Friday. One more thing before we circulate wider.

internal memo for kaduf-baduf: Only 35 of the 378 pilot accounts renewed Holir, so a churn review is set for June 11. Eliielax Group is in early talks to buy Silaelix Group for about $142.1 million.